The Learning Disabilities Association of Kingston (LDAK) is a charity dedicated to improving the lives of children, youth and adults with learning disabilities.

Presented by the Regional Assessment and Resource Centre (RARC) RARC is inviting you to their upcoming virtual Post-Secondary Transition Information Night, designed for Grade 11 and 12 students with LD, ADHD, ASD, and mental health disorders. This FREE event will provide valuable information to help students and families plan and prepare for the transition from high school to post-secondary education....
